Debate: It Is Time To Lift Sanctions Against Burma

02 December 2009, 6:45-8:30pm


Should Aung San Suu Kyi change her position and call for the removal of sanctions on the junta?

Speakers for the motion:

Thant Myint-U, Author of the acclaimed history of Burma The River of Lost Footsteps.

Dr Frank Smithuis, Medical doctor who ran Médecins Sans Frontières-Holland in Burma for 15 years.

Derek Tonkin, Former ambassador to both Vietnam and Thailand, and currently chairman of Network Myanmar.

Speakers against the motion:

John Bercow, Conservative MP and former Shadow Secretary of State for International Development.

Mark Farmaner, Director of Burma Campaign.

Benedict Rogers, South-East Asia team leader for Christian Solidarity Worldwide.

Brad Adams, Executive director of Human Rights Watch's Asia Division

Organiser: Intelligence Squared
Venue: Savoy Place, 2 Savoy Place, London
